Firefighters are now in the 18th day of their battle with the Sleeper Lake Fire and it has not yet been laid to rest. Late today high winds and drought conditions caused multiple spot fires between County Road 407 and the western containment line. Firefighters will work late into the evening to contain these spot fires.
County Road 407 has been closed between M123 and Pine Stump Junction. County Road 407 has been evacuated between Dawson Creek and Halfway Lake. The power was turned off temporarily but has been restored.
Firefighters continue to control and mop up the Diverted Flight fire that was spotted yesterday near Hulbert in Chippewa County. That fire is estimated at 14.9 acres.
The fire is still estimated at 67% containment and the acreage is still at 18,020 acres. Hopefully there will be more info later this a.m.
